Brown backs gang tax

| | Comments (0) |

In a last minute boost to the Measure A campaign, Attorney General Jerry Brown is supporting the $36 a year parcel tax proposal on next Tuesday's ballot.
Brown joins Mayor Antonio Villaraigosa and Police Chieff Bill Bratton in backing the measure, that was developed by Councilwoman Janice Hahn to develop a $30 million a year funding stream to pay for gang intervention and prevention programs.
